Since for the past month or so I have been doing a clean bulk I have decided to jump back on NHE (Natural Hormonal Enhancement) for a while. To those of you who are unfamiliar with NHE I am going to quicky sum up the diet.

Basically its a ketogenic diet 95% of the time, and then 2 meals per week are carb-up meals. Every 3rd and then 4th night are regular carb-up meals. Basically eating as much carbs as one can tolerate in about 30 minutes.

However, the first 7 days of the diet is strictly ketogenic without any carb-up meals at all. This is to put the body into fat-burning mode, but ketosis is not a priority. In the book Faigin mentions ketosis, but talks about how its not an essential part of the diet, at all.
